What does the word "Bluelines" mean?

The term "Bluelines" has various meanings depending on the context in which it is used. Generally, it refers to a visual representation or a specific technique in design, printing, or publishing. Below, we will explore the different interpretations and applications of "Bluelines" across various industries.

1. In Graphic Design: Bluelines can refer to the preliminary proofs that are produced before the final printing process. These proofs are often created using a blue ink or a blue line for ease of identification and to ensure that all elements are correctly aligned and positioned. Designers can make adjustments based on the blueline proofs, leading to a refined final product.

2. In Printing: In the printing industry, bluelines are used as a quality control measure. They serve as mock-ups that allow printers to verify that all elements — text, images, and colors — appear as intended. Traditionally, these bluelines were produced through a photomechanical process that rendered images in blue. While technology has evolved, the term still holds relevance for pre-press evaluations.

3. In Comics and Animation: Bluelines can also refer to the light blue pencil lines that comic artists use when sketching their illustrations. These lines are later removed or eliminated in the inking stage, leaving only the finalized artwork. This technique helps artists maintain clean lines while allowing flexibility in the drawing process.

4. In Fashion Design: Fashion designers may use bluelines to create patterns or technical sketches of garments. These outlines help in visualizing the final product and are crucial for understanding how the fabric will flow and fit once constructed.

5. In Music: Interestingly, "Bluelines" has also found its place in music, notably as the name of an influential album by the British trip-hop group Massive Attack, released in 1991. The album explored themes of urban life and emotional depth, contributing significantly to the trip-hop genre.

6. In Sports: In certain sports, particularly in ice hockey, bluelines refer to the blue lines on the rink that demarcate territorial zones. They play a critical role in determining offside plays and other strategic elements of the game.
